Driver in hospital after car overturns in Headcorn High Street

A man was taken to hospital after his car overturned in a village high street.

The accident happened at about 6.45pm yesterday in Headcorn after a collision with another vehicle.

Three fire engines attended and crews had to first stabilize the vehicle, which was resting on its roof, before helping to release the elderly driver.

The road was closed during the operation but was reopened later after fire crews moved the vehicle off the road.

They were able to leave the scene at 7.30pm.

The driver’s injuries were said not to be life-threatening.
